Former Gents Soccer Player Jaime Frias Named Development Coach For U.S. Youth Women's National Teams

Note: Former Centenary Gent soccer player Jaime Frias (1996-2000) was named as the Development Coach For U.S. Youth Women's National Teams. In his four seasons with Centenary, he scored five goals and recorded four assists for 16 points.

CHICAGO (May 11, 2016) - U.S. Soccer has announced the hiring of Jaime Frias as a U.S. Soccer Development Coach for the Youth Women's and Girls' National Teams.

Frias will work closely with U.S. Soccer Women's Technical Director April Heinrichs and the other Development Coaches in all aspects of the USA's Youth National Team programs. Along with his role as a Development Coach, Frias will also be the head coach for the Under-16 Girls' National Team.
